A disastrous comment by Santos and then a great comeback
Talking about the West Wing, of course, which mirrors reality almost too much that I can understand why its numbers are plummeting. Who wants to see the same stuff as in real life, when all one wants is sheer escapism?

Anyway, a reporter asked Catholic Santos his opinion on Intelligent Design. He was on his way out, but returned and said: I believe in god and I know he is intelligent.

Oh no!! Josh looked like he was hit be a lightning.

But then he was asked again, by an English teacher and first he said the same thing then, when asked about teaching it, he said that evolution is based on scientific finding and should be taught in science class, while IG is based on faith and has no place in science class.

This, by the way, is what I thought he should say so I was glad that we are in agreement...

And, I wish that Kerry replied in a similar line when he was asked about abortion and started by saying that his faith forbids it, etc.
